No Ordinary Family

Last night was the pilot episode for ABC- No Ordinary Family. Being the geek that I am I had to watch, even giving up NCIS.  Now I have not watch any show on ABC in Some time because nothing has looked good. I believe the last show i watch on a regular  base was Lois and Clark. 

Now the main cast I loved.

Michael Chiklis MySpace MTV Tower During Comic iovLeKzrWPRl

Michael Chiklis Coming from “the shield” and “fanatic four” comes out as the out of place dad feeling like the world is passing him by. The family is breaking up right in front of his eyes and all he wants to do is get his family back on track.   

Julie Benz Coming from the hit show “Dexter”, Where she died, Plays the hard working mom wow only goal in life is to climb the leader.

The Show started with Jim Powell (Michael Chiklis) wanting the family to go with Stephanie Powell (Julie Benz) on vacation/work trip. After a plane crash Jim finds that he is super strong. Stephanie, having no time finds that she can run at the speed of sound.  They have 2 children a girl and a boy. the girl can read minds and the boy finds that he has vast intelligence

As i watched this show i find myself liking it more and more and I was also thinking about after it was over. I could really relate with the dad in so many ways. That was one of the biggest things for me to find in a show. 

I am hoping for the best with this show because it looks to be a great family show. I will have to turn off NCIS for another week to see what happens next.  Overall I give the show a 8 out of 10.

The Story of My Call

So about 5 weeks ago I decided to write the story of my call to ministry for a project for school.  i wanted to do this because i is a very important story in my life and just seeing what God has done for a person like me is amazing. i am not done with it yet but i would like to shear the first part of it with you tonight. Now remember this is not the final thing so there might be some miss spellings and fun things like that, but i hope you enjoy.

The beginning of the call

For I know the plans I have for you" the LORD's declaration—"plans for [your] welfare, not for disaster, to give you a future and a hope. Jeremiah 29:11 (HCSB)

Let me start this story of right, “In the Beginning...” no no, how about, “in 1994 one of my best friends died.” Not the best way to start but this is where my calling started. On June 16, 1994 my best friend, Cory William Rock was killed. He was on his bike and was run over by a water truck. This was the first time in my life that death had hit me close to home and I did not know what to do. Cory was hit in the afternoon, I remember it well, it was a Friday, very nice out, and I almost just cut off my finger. We were picking up my bother from daycare and my cousin stopped and told me that our friend was ran over and it did not look like he would make it.

My mom had to work for the police station that night, she cleaned the offices for them and I wanted to go see the movie playing in town to get my mind off things. As I was there that night I seen an old friend that I had not seen in years. Her name was Desiree Brookman and I had known her from the school bus. She was married to Darren Brookman who happened to be a cop of the town I lived in. After the movie, on the way home, I asked my mom if she though Cory would be ok and that when she pulled the car over and told me that Cory had died. Darren was the one that told my mother and then as my mother ask “how will I tell Willie?” Darren told her that He would go and pick me up and be the one to tell me. My mother declined but later I find out that Darren called his wife to seat up at the movie theater and was to keep an eye on me and get me to the police station if someone had told me before my mother could.

It was because of what Darren was willing to do for a 14 year old kid that I first heard my calling from God. I was to help other for the rest of my life.

Now let me fast forward about 10 years. I was working at a pizza place, not a Christian and it was a Sunday. Rev. Morris Ball came in around 11am, dressed in a suit and tie and order a pizza. I asked him if he was coming from or going to and he told me he was come from church and going home. As we talked he told me that he was the pastor of St. Charles Christian Church and as he said that I made a joke saying, “That seems like an easy job, maybe I should do that.” He looked at me and said, “Well if you want to talk about it then come by the church tomorrow.

So the next day we meet and I told him my story and then he said something that changed my life. “People need helped in other ways, more than just physically.” That night I gave my life to Christ and hand my life over to Him and to do His work.
